Solid wire crimps fall apart in my experience, using Yellow die for 12-10awg.
Perhaps solid-wire crimps pass UL testing, until the device is shoved into the box, or the wire bends, and deforms the crimp.
Maybe cheep off the shelf vinyl crimps wont reliably hold solid wire, when devices are pushed & pulled around.
